Entrepreneurial Mindset. The key to success for undergraduate engineering students.

Engineers can no longer depend on just their technical skill set to be successful. They also need an entrepreneurial mindset. An entrepreneurial mindset (EM) encompasses attitudes, habits, and behaviors that shape a unique approach to problem-solving, innovation, and value creation.

The 3Cs of Entrepreneurial Mindset: Curiosity, Connections, and Creating Value.
A thorough understanding of the 3Cs helps engineering students question, adapt, and make positive change in classes, campus, communities, and the world.

The Kern Family Foundation has catalyzed EM through KEEN: Kern Entrepreneurial Engineering Network.

AI can out-produce code, but it can’t connect the dots: 

How do you become a great [cybersecurity engineer]? You spend years as a junior, mid-level, and senior developer. You learn by doing, failing, and executing.

What we’ll desperately need are engineers who connect business risk, human behavior, and complex systems to anticipate the attacks nobody has scripted yet.

I’m convinced the answer is Entrepreneurially Minded Learning (EML), the framework developed by KEEN (the Kern Entrepreneurial Engineering Network), built on a simple equation: Mindset + Skillset.

Curiosity (chase the context not given in the prompt). Connections (link technical decisions to other domains). Value Creation (security as business survival, not serverlocking).

Mindset alone doesn’t build judgment. Judgment used to come from a decade of breaking things as a junior.

EML has to do something harder than “teach curiosity”; it has to compress or replace the scar tissue that once came from years in the trenches.

Why We’re In KEEN
We already embrace much of the KEEN Framework in our values and approach to engineering education. As a faculty, CEC has brought its own entrepreneurial mindset to our programs and initiatives. Discovery, inquiry, and synthesis are core values of the Mason student experience.

There are many examples of highly innovative programs we have created, such as:

  • We created the first-ever BS in Cyber Security Engineering, and ABET modeled its program criteria after our curriculum.
  • We pioneered a very creative dual-admission/transfer program for community college students, and approximately half of our 11,000 students follow that pathway to Mason.
